New bipartisan bill would let retirees use their 401(k) to make direct charitable donations

A new bipartisan bill aims to allow retirees to make direct charitable donations from their 401(k) accounts. Currently, qualified charitable distributions can only be made from individual retirement accounts for people aged 70 1/2. The proposed change would expand donation options for retirees.
